Contents:
"Get me home" -- The foundation for all loving relationships -- The priceless value of affirmation -- Meaningful touch -- Building character and responsibility -- "Are you listening to me?" -- Valuing our differences -- Blending our differences -- Untying the knots of anger -- Resolving conflict -- The glue that bonds a family -- How to help your family improve -- Preparing for transitions -- Vision -- When a child walks away from the light -- When life overflows -- Watching for the sunlight -- A final thought: where your light shines best.
Review: "... you know your kids will face trials and struggles after they leave the nest. But you can begin to prepare your children today ... by building solid and lasting relationships that will see them through the tough times." - back cover.
